Imingcele yezobuchwepheshe eyinhloko

Izinto Izici
I-Operation Temperature Range ≤120V.DC -55℃~+105℃ ; 160~500V.DC -40℃~+105℃
I-Voltage elinganiselwe 10~500V.DC
Ukubekezelela Amandla ±20% (25±2℃ 120Hz)
Ukuvuza kwamanje((uA) 10~120WV |≤0.01CV noma 3uA noma yikuphi okukhulu C:umthamo olinganiselwe(uF) V:i-voltage elinganiselwe(V) 2 imizuzu yokufunda
160 〜500WV |≤0.02CV+10(uA) C:isilinganiso somthamo(uF) V:i-voltage elinganiselwe(V) 2 imizuzu yokufunda
I-Disipation Factor (25±2℃ 120Hz) I-Voltage elinganiselwe(V) 10 16 25 35 50 63 80 100
tgδ 0.19 0.16 0.14 0.12 0.1 0.09 0.09 0.09
I-Voltage elinganiselwe(V) 120 160 200 250 350 400 450 500
tgδ 0.09 0.09 0.08 0.08 0.1 0.1 0.12 0.2
Kulabo abanamandla alinganiselwe amakhulu kuno-1000uF, lapho amandla alinganiselwe enyuka ngo-1000uF, khona-ke i-tgδ izokwenyuka ngo-0.02
Izici Zezinga lokushisa (120Hz) I-Voltage elinganiselwe(V) 10 16 25 35 50 63 80 100
Z(-40℃)/Z(20℃) 6 4 3 3 3 3 3 3
I-Voltage elinganiselwe(V) 120 160 200 250 350 400 450 500
Z(-40℃)/Z(20℃) 5 5 5 5 7 7 7 8
Ukukhuthazela Ngemuva kwesikhathi sokuhlola esijwayelekile ngokusebenzisa i-voltage elinganiselwe ne-ripple current elinganiselwe kuhhavini engu-105℃, imininingwane elandelayo izokwaneliswa ngemva kwamahora angu-16 ku-25±2°C.
Ukushintsha kwamandla ngaphakathi kwe±20% yenani lokuqala
I-Disipation Factor Ingabi ngaphezu kuka-200% yenani elishiwo
Ukuvuza kwamanje Hhayi ngaphezu kwenani elishiwo
Layisha impilo(amahora) Φ5 7000hrs
Φ6.3 9000hrs
≥Φ8 10000 amahora
I-Shelf Life At High Temperature Ngemva kokushiya ama-capacitor ngaphansi komthwalo ku-105℃ amahora angu-1000, imininingwane elandelayo izokwaneliswa ku-25±2℃.
Ukushintsha kwamandla ngaphakathi kwe±20% yenani lokuqala
I-Disipation Factor Ingabi ngaphezu kuka-200% yenani elishiwo
Ukuvuza kwamanje Ingabi ngaphezu kuka-200% yenani elishiwo

I-Ripple current frequency correct coefficient

① Isici Sokulungisa Imvamisa

Imvamisa (Hz) 50 120 1K 10K-50K 100K
I-Coefficient 0.4 0.5 0.8 0.9 1

② Isici Sokulungisa Izinga lokushisa

Izinga Lokushisa Lemvelo(℃) 50℃ 70℃ 85℃ 105℃
Isici Sokulungisa 2.1 1.8 1.4 1

1.Iyini i-aluminium electrolytic capacitor?I-aluminium electrolytic capacitor iwuhlobo lwe-capacitor esebenzisa i-electrolyte ukuze kuzuzwe amandla aphezulu kunezinye izinhlobo zama-capacitor.Yakhiwe ngamafoyili amabili e-aluminium ahlukaniswe yiphepha elifakwe ku-electrolyte.

2.Isebenza kanjani?Lapho i-voltage isetshenziswa ku-capacitor kagesi, i-electrolyte iqhuba ugesi futhi ivumela i-capacitor electronic ukugcina amandla.Amafoyili e-aluminium asebenza njengama-electrode, futhi iphepha elifakwe ku-electrolyte lisebenza njenge-dielectric.

3.Iziphi izinzuzo zokusebenzisa i-aluminium electrolytic capacitors?Ama-Aluminium electrolytic capacitor ane-capacitance ephezulu, okusho ukuthi angagcina amandla amaningi endaweni encane.Abuye angabizi futhi angakwazi ukuphatha ama-voltages aphezulu.

I-4.Yiziphi izinkinga zokusebenzisa i-aluminium electrolytic capacitor?Okunye okungalungile kokusebenzisa i-aluminium electrolytic capacitor ukuthi inobude bempilo obulinganiselwe.I-electrolyte ingakwazi ukuma ngokuhamba kwesikhathi, okungabangela izingxenye ze-capacitor ukuthi zihluleke.Ziyakwazi futhi ukuzwela ukushisa futhi zingalimala uma zibhekene namazinga okushisa aphezulu.

5.Iziphi ezinye izinhlelo zokusebenza ezivamile ze-aluminium electrolytic capacitors?I-Aluminium electrolytic capacitor ivame ukusetshenziswa ezintweni zikagesi, izinto ezilalelwayo, nezinye izinto zikagesi ezidinga amandla aphezulu.Zibuye zisetshenziswe ezinhlelweni zezimoto, njengakusistimu yokuthungela.

6.Ukhetha kanjani i-aluminium electrolytic capacitor efanele yohlelo lwakho lokusebenza?Uma ukhetha i-aluminium electrolytic capacitor, udinga ukucabangela amandla, isilinganiso se-voltage, nezinga lokushisa.Udinga futhi ukucabangela usayizi nokuma kwe-capacitor, kanye nezinketho zokufaka.

7.Uyinakekela kanjani i-aluminium electrolytic capacitor?Ukuze unakekele i-aluminium electrolytic capacitor, kufanele ugweme ukuyibeka emazingeni okushisa aphezulu kanye nama-voltage aphezulu.Kufanele futhi ugweme ukuzifaka ngaphansi kokucindezeleka komshini noma ukudlidliza.Uma i-capacitor isetshenziswa ngokungavamile, kufanele ngezikhathi ezithile usebenzise i-voltage kuyo ukuze ugcine i-electrolyte ingomi.
